Our Neglect Matters campaign launched on 7th June with 5 “Lunch and Learn” sessions. These sessions were attended by over 1400 professionals and practitioners from across the Partnership and were recorded so sessions can be revisited or listened to for the first time if you were unable to join the events live. Below is a brief overview of what each session covered and the slides for each day. Live recordings will be uploaded in due course.
